Christian graces…

2Pe 1:3-10 KJV  According as his divine power hath given unto us all things that pertain unto life and godliness, through the knowledge of him that hath called us to glory and virtue:  4  Whereby are given unto us exceeding great and precious promises: that by these ye might be partakers of the divine nature, having escaped the corruption that is in the world through lust.  5  And beside this, giving all diligence, add to your faith virtue; and to virtue knowledge;  6  And to knowledge temperance; and to temperance patience; and to patience godliness;  7  And to godliness brotherly kindness; and to brotherly kindness charity.  8  For if these things be in you, and abound, they make you that ye shall neither be barren nor unfruitful in the knowledge of our Lord Jesus Christ.  9  But he that lacks these things is blind, and cannot see afar off, and hath forgotten that he was purged from his old sins.  10  Wherefore the rather, brethren, give diligence to make your calling and election sure: for if ye do these things, ye shall never fall:

 

All diligence…all your effort…all your resources…to be Godly men…

  1. Faith…without faith it is impossible to please God… Heb 11:1 KJV  Now faith is the substance of things hoped for, the evidence of things not seen…we have to believe God exist and we are trying to please Him with our conduct.

  2. Virtue…moral excellence…holy character…purest intentions…the doing of good deeds…

  3. Knowledge…knowledge of how to be Holy…knowing what to do in order to do good deeds

  4. Temperance…self-control…self-discipline…self-will surrender…having a sound mind making sound moral decisions

  5. Patience…the not growing weary in well doing…the bearing up under trials…the endurance of applying knowing with virtue and faith.

  6. Godliness…the character of the Holy…the result of applying self-control with patience while exercising the virtue and faith needed to be of Godly character.

  7. Brotherly Kindness…be kind to Christians…know how we treat others the Lord will treat us… Mat 7:1-2 KJV  Judge not, that ye be not judged.  2  For with what judgment ye judge, ye shall be judged: and with what measure ye mete, it shall be measured to you again.

  8. Charity…love for all souls…if you treat everybody like Jesus then you will receive the same treatment as you gave… Eph 6:5-9 KJV  Servants, be obedient to them that are your masters according to the flesh, with fear and trembling, in singleness of your heart, as unto Christ;  6  Not with eyeservice, as men pleasers; but as the servants of Christ, doing the will of God from the heart;  7  With good will doing service, as to the Lord, and not to men:  8  Knowing that whatsoever good thing any man doeth, the same shall he receive of the Lord, whether he be bond or free.  9  And, ye masters, do the same things unto them, forbearing threatening: knowing that your Master also is in heaven; neither is there respect of persons with him.
